Title: wooden tomb figure
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Centre for Visual
Description: Carved wooden tomb figure. The figure is carved in a simplistic form with a head, body and arms but no legs; the only identifiable facial feature is the nose.
The figure is in fairly poor condition.
Title: small painted red earthenware pot
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Cen
Description: Neolithic ware. Thinly potted light brick-red earthenware funerary jar with two loop handles and a flat base. The upper two thirds of the body are painted in dark brown with geometric designs in concentric horizontal bands. There is a narrow solid band around the rim of the jar, with two wider bands of cross-hatched pattern and another narrow solid band below. Title: ivory and jade opium pipe
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Centre for
Description: Yellow ivory and green jade opium pipe.
Long and slender opium pipe carved from yellow ivory, slightly splayed at either end. The mouthpiece is a small, circular hole at one end of the shaft. About two-thirds of the length from the mouthpiece is a damascened metal mount, decorated with a fan, a scene showing a mythical beast with books (symbols of learning), two shou characters (the symbol for longevity) and a seal script inscription within an oval frame. Title: painting of tribute presentation
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ury
Description: Handscroll of a court scene depicting courtiers and foreigners bringing gifts to the emperor. The painting is symmetrical: both architecturally and the numbers of people on each side are balanced. In total 90 people are portrayed including court attendants and those presenting gifts. Two animals are shown, a lion and an elephant.

Title: inlaid shallow celadon bowl
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Centre fo
Description: Stoneware inlaid celadon bowl with rounded sides and foot. The bowl is inlaid on both the interior and exterior with a white and black slip decoration under a green celadon glaze. There are four stylised chrysanthemums within a scrolling foliage border on the exterior of the bowl, with four stylised chrysanthemums below. Title: Han tomb brick
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Centre for Visual Arts
Description: Slightly U-shaped, solid, rectangular ornamental tomb brick of grey fire clay with an impressed decoration in low relief. On the front, concave face of the brick is a banner-bearing equestrian figure with a two-character horizontal inscription above and an eight-character vertical inscription to the left. Title: incomplete crossbow trigger mechanism
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ury
Description: Part of a cast bronze trigger mechanism for a crossbow. Only the frame and hook of the mechanism remain; the two pins, trigger rest and trigger are missing.
The mechanism shows signs of corrosion.

Title: Ming blue and white dish
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Centre for V
Description: Thickly potted blue and white porcelain dish with a plain rim, slightly rounded sides and a finely cut foot-ring.
The dish is decorated in deep underglaze blue. A bunch of lotus, sagittaria and water chestnut tied with a narrow ribbon is painted at the centre of the dish. This is surrounded by a composite flower scroll in the cavetto and a narrow band of classic scroll below the rim. Title: Japanese Buddha
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Centre for Visual Art
Description: Gold lacquered wooden figure of a seated Buddha.
The Buddha is seated in Dhyanasana (lotus position) on a lotus plinth, with his right hand resting on his right knee with palm inwards and left hand on his lap with palm upwards in Bhumisparsha Mudra (gesture of touching the earth). He wears flowing robes with a serene expression, long earlobes and tight curls surmounted by a domed usnisa. His facial features are roughly painted in black.

Title: Burmese Buddha
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Centre for Visual Arts
Description: Cast gilt bronze seated Buddha.
The Buddha is seated in Dhyanasana (lotus position) on a double lotus plinth, with his right hand touching a lotus on the ground and left hand on his lap with palm upwards in Bhumisparsha Mudra (gesture of touching the earth). He wears tightly fitting robes with a serene expression, long earlobes and tight spiral curls surmounted by a domed usnisa. The urna between the eyebrows is inlaid with turquoise.

Title: Tibetan figure of a Buddhist deity
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sainsbury Ce
Description: Tibetan cast bronze seated four-armed Buddhist deity, on a stand.
The Buddha is seated in Dhyanasana (lotus position) on a double lotus plinth, with his principal hands held in front of the breast, with the left palm turned inward (toward the body) and the right turned outward, and the circles formed by the thumbs and index fingers of each hand touch one another in Dharmachakra Mudra (gesture of teaching). Title: stela with the figure of the Buddha Amitabha
VADS Collection: Artworld: Sa
Description: Buddhist stele with the figure of the Buddha Amitabha, carved from a single block of limestone.
The back of the stele is arched and curves forwards at the top. The larger upper register of the stele shows the Buddha Amitabha standing barefoot on a low lotus plinth and surrounded by an incised nimbus, aureole and flames.
